Children with reading difficulties and children with a history of repeated ear infections (Otitis Media, OM) are both thought to have phonological impairments, but for quite different reasons. This paper examines the profile of phonological and morphological awareness in poor readers and children with OM. Thirty‐three poor readers were compared to individually matched chronological age and reading age controls. Their phonological awareness and morphological awareness skills were consistently at the level of reading age matched controls. Unexpectedly, a significant minority (25%) of the poor readers had some degree of undiagnosed mild or very mild hearing loss. Twenty‐nine children with a history of OM and their matched controls completed the same battery of tasks. They showed relatively small delays in their literacy and showed no impairment in morphological awareness but had phonological awareness scores below the level of reading age matched controls. Further analysis suggested that this weakness in phonological awareness was carried by a specific weakness in segmenting and blending phonemes, with relatively good performance on phoneme manipulation tasks. Results suggest that children with OM show a circumscribed deficit in phoneme segmentation and blending, while poor readers show a broader metalinguistic impairment which is more closely associated with reading difficulties.  相似文献

This study reports the reading difficulties of five children following unilateral left hemisphere stroke sustained either before or during the early stages of literacy acquisition. Although each of the children experienced a period of disturbed language processing in the initial stages postonset, at the time of testing none of the children were considered to be clinically aphasic. Yet, on a standardized test of oral reading each of the children achieved a reading age that lagged behind chronological age and marked reading impairments were disclosed in four of the five children. A set of standardized and nonstandardized tests, aimed at measuring aspects of cognitive and spoken language processing that are considered to be important for normal reading acquisition, was administered. Where nonstandardized tests were used, performance of each of the stroke children was compared to that of groups of normally developing control children, closely matched for chronological age. A range of residual deficits in cognitive and spoken language processing was disclosed among the five brain-damaged children that appeared to be associated with their reading impairments. Two children had expectedly poor reading due to a selective impairment in verbal IQ; a specific phonological reading disorder was revealed in two children, each of which had a residual impairment to phonological awareness; and delayed reading acquisition was observed in one child with a general language deficit. It is suggested that when a child suffers damage to the left hemisphere in the early stages of reading acquisition, difficulties with learning to read are likely to ensue and may arise as a consequence of an underlying cognitive or linguistic deficit.  相似文献

The picture and word naming performance of developmental dyslexics was compared to the picture and word naming performance of non-dyslexic (“garden variety”) poor readers, reading age, and chronological age-matched controls. The stimulus list used for both tasks was systematically manipulated for word length and word frequency. In order to examine picture naming errors in more depth, an object name recognition test assessed each subject's vocabulary knowledge of those names which they were unable to spontaneously label in the picture naming task. Findings indicated that the dyslexic and the garden variety poor readers exhibited a picture naming deficit relative to both chronological and reading age-matched controls. Findings also indicated that both groups of impaired readers obtained superior scores in the word naming task than in the picture naming task, while both groups of controls showed no difference in performance across tasks. The dyslexics' picture naming errors, but not those of the garden variety poor readers, were particularly marked on polysyllabic and/or low frequency words, indicating a possible phonological basis to the picture naming deficit of the dyslexic children. These children also recognized significantly more unnamed target words than all comparison groups, suggesting a particular difficulty inretrievingthe phonological codes of known picture names rather than a vocabulary deficit. Results are discussed in terms of dyslexics' difficulty in encoding full segmental phonological representations of names in long-term memory and/or in processing these representations in order to generate required names on demand.  相似文献

To clarify the nature of cognitive deficits experienced by poor readers, 9-10-yr.-old poor readers were matched against 9 chronological age and 9 younger reading age-matched controls screened and selected from regular classrooms. Poor readers performed significantly more poorly than chronological age-matched peers on digit naming speed, spoonerisms, and nonsense word reading. Poor readers were also significantly poorer than reading age-matched controls on nonword reading but were significantly better than reading age-matched controls on postural stability. Analyses of effect sizes were consistent with these findings, showing strong effects for digit naming speed, spoonerisms, and nonword reading. However, effect size analysis also suggested that poor readers experienced moderate difficulties with balance automatisation but did not show verbal speech perception deficits relative to either control  相似文献

This study assessed theory of mind understanding in children with congenital profound visual impairment (CPVI): children who have had no access to visual information throughout development. Participants were 18 children with CPVI and no other impairments, aged between 5 and 11 years, and 18 children with normal vision, matched individually on chronological age, verbal IQ and verbal mental age. Three first‐order false belief tasks were presented twice each; the three tasks varied in the extent of deception and involvement of the child. Six of the children with CPVI failed one or more of the false belief tasks; all sighted children passed all of the tasks. The manipulations of deception and involvement did not influence the performance of the children with CPVI. Participant characteristics of the children with CPVI were examined in relation to their performance on the false belief tasks: chronological age and type of school attended were not found to be related to performance; verbal IQ and verbal mental age were found to differ in children with good and poor performance on the false belief tasks. The results are consistent with either a general pattern of delay in theory of mind development for children with CPVI, or with a subset of children who have longer‐term difficulties in this area.  相似文献

The inhibitory and facilitatory effects of context on word recognition were investigated in 24 8-to 10-year-old children with a specific reading disability in comparison with a group of 24 children matched for reading ability and a group of 24 children matched for chronological age. To avoid confounding the effects of reading level with those of word difficulty, target words of equivalent relative familiarity for each participant were presented in congruous, neutral, and incongruous sentence contexts. In agreement with previous studies, there was clear evidence of both general inhibitory and facilitatory effects. In contrast to previous findings, however, reading level did not have a major impact on the inhibition of word recognition in incongruous contexts compared with neutral contexts, although it may have led to greater facilitation in congruous contexts compared with neutral contexts. Although further research is required, these results suggest that if reading-age appropriate materials are selected, less skilled readers and those with a reading disability may not be as influenced by context as has been claimed previously.  相似文献

The phonological skills are not the only linguistic abilities which are observed to have some influence on reading achievement in dyslexics. In addition to phonological skills, morphological skills should be also taken in consideration. The aim of this study is to extend investigation the linguistic abilities of children with dyslexia to the morphological level through examination whether there is a lack of morphological knowledge in children with dyslexia for Bosnian language with transparent orthography. Testing sample included 45 children with dyslexia that are compared with chronological age and reading level controls. The dyslexic children performed significantly worse than same age controls on all forms of word and the most complex word formation tasks. Based on the examination of standardized discriminant function coefficients the variable with the highest weight in defining the first discriminant function was the suffixal formation, declination of personal pronouns, changing gender of adjectives with regard to the gender of a noun, and changing of gender of cardinal numbers with regard to the gender of a noun best differentiates groups. Results of multivariate analyses of variance also showed that chronological age and reading level groups outperformed dyslexics on all these tasks. Our results suggest that dyslexics have problems with morphological knowledge which indicate that certain actions regarding the development of morphological abilities in dyslexics should be taken in the elementary grades.  相似文献

The paper reports a series of studies of reading and metaphonological processing by children in their second year in primary school(aged 6 years). An earlier study had established that, in the first year of learning, performance was characterized by a small-unit approach in which graphemes and phonemes were emphasized. In the second year, reading became more sensitiveto the frequencies of rime structures in the lexicon. Capacity to generate word analogies for nonwords also showed increasing commitment to rime-based responses, and this trend was strongly linked to reading age. The present results suggest that a small-unit approach to reading is augmented by a large-unit approach as development proceeds. This trend was reflected in performance on a test of explicit phonological awareness. When asked to report the segment of sound shared by two spoken words, Primary 1 children were poor in reporting shared rimes but relatively adept in reporting shared phonemes. During Primary 2 there was an improvement in ability to report shared rimes, and this trend was also related to reading age. These results are discussed in relation to the influence of instruction and the nature of the orthography in determining the course of reading development.  相似文献

In the present study, the effect of word length on lexical decision in dyslexic and normal reading children was investigated. Dyslexics of 10-years old, chronological age controls, and reading age controls read words and pseudowords consisting of 3 to 6 letters in a lexical decision task. Length effects were much stronger in dyslexics and reading age controls than in chronological age controls. These results support the contention that dyslexics continue to rely on a predominantly sub-lexical reading procedure, whereas for normal readers the contribution of a lexical reading procedure increases. The relevance of the findings for current computational models of reading is discussed.  相似文献

There has been a recent debate about the utilization of phonological information by poor readers in both working memory and reading tasks. The purpose of the first experiment in this study was to examine whether the absence of phonological similarity effects in working memory reported in previous studies was due to inappropriate levels of task difficulty. Poor readers and their reading age controls were found to show a normal effect when the memory task was at an appropriate level of difficulty, but no effect when a large number of items had to be recalled. However, in a recognition memory task, the poor readers chose orthographically similar pairs, whereas the reading-age and chronological age controls chose phonologically similar pairs. The purpose of a final experiment was to determine whether or not the good and poor readers could be differentiated in terms of their reading strategies; both groups showed regularity effects in a naming task and pseudohomophone effects in a lexical decision task. However, although poor readers could read three-letter nonwords as well as their controls, they were significantly impaired in reading more complex one-syllable nonwords. It was concluded that poor readers may have a phonological dysfunction in some aspects of reading that is unrelated to whether or not they show phonological similarity effects in working memory. Impaired segmentation skills may underly their difficulties in both reading and nonreading tasks.  相似文献

Eleven-year-old severely impaired poor readers failed to show a word length effect with pictorial presentation, but showed an effect of equal magnitude to that of reading age and chronological age controls with auditory presentation. The lack of a pictorial word length effect was unlikely to be due to slow speed of naming skills, as in one study these were at least as fast as those of the reading age controls. It is possible that the poor readers failed to verbally encode the pictures. However, they reported using verbal rehearsal, and lip movements were often observed during presentation, suggesting that they did verbally encode the items. Therefore they may have failed to show a word length effect because they did not retrieve information from the phonological store at recall. Although the poor readers had impaired naming speed skills for their age on both discrete item identification and articulation rate tasks, they could not be equated with their chronological age controls on memory span or reading when these naming speed differences were controlled. However, the groups were matched on the naming speed measures when differences in reading ability were controlled.  相似文献

The purpose of this research was to investigate rule learning in reading disabled (RD) and normal children (chronological age and reading age (RA) match) when required to (a) abstract rules independently, and (b) use rules after instruction. Study 1 required the children to solve problems using shapes and letters. Although there was no difference between groups in the rate of problem solving when children were asked to abstract rules independently, the pattern of errors was different. The RD children made a greater proportion of errors on the negative instance for the more complex problems. In particular, this occurred on the letter task which involved psycholinguistic categorization. After instruction, the RA controls made more errors than the other groups. Study 2 was an analogous pseudoword reading task. Even with statistical adjustment for differences in prior grapheme-phoneme (g-p) rule knowledge, the RD children performed less accurately than the RA controls when they had to abstract rules, although this was restricted to the most difficult rule (rule of e). There was no difference after instruction in rule application, although the pattern of errors and post-test results indicated that the RD children continued to experience decoding difficulty. These results suggest a phonologically based productive deficit which interferes with the learning of g-p rules. This may be part of a more general language deficit which includes psycholinguistic categorization. Despite the severity of this handicap, RD children seem responsive to instruction.  相似文献

Previous studies have shown that children suffering from developmental dyslexia have a deficit in categorical perception of speech sounds. The aim of the current study was to better understand the nature of this categorical perception deficit. In this study, categorical perception skills of children with dyslexia were compared with those of chronological age and reading level controls. Children identified and discriminated /do-to/ syllables along a voice onset time (VOT) continuum. Results showed that children with dyslexia discriminated among phonemically contrastive pairs less accurately than did chronological age and reading level controls and also showed higher sensitivity in the discrimination of allophonic contrasts. These results suggest that children with dyslexia perceive speech with allophonic units rather than phonemic units. The origin of allophonic perception in the course of perceptual development and its implication for reading acquisition are discussed.  相似文献

Some research on developmental dyslexia focuses on linguistic abnormalities such as poor reading of nonwords or poor reading of exception words. Other research focuses on visual abnormalities such as poor performance on psychophysical tasks believed to assess the functioning of the magnocellular and parvocellular layers of the lateral geniculate nucleus (LGN). Little is known about what the relationships are between these two types of abnormalities. We measured nonword reading, exception word reading, and performance with Ternus apparent movement displays (the perception of which is believed to depend upon the magnocellular and parvocellular pathways) in dyslexic children and children without reading difficulties. Our results indicate that performance on the Ternus task is related to nonword reading ability but not to exception word reading ability. We offer two alternative interpretations of these findings. According to the first of these, nonword reading requires a serial left-to-right allocation of covert attention across the letter string being read and the neural systems involved in this attentional process also play a part in responses to the Ternus display. According to the second, poor nonword reading and abnormal Ternus performance are not directly related: perinatal/neurodevelopmental insult has affected the LGN (influencing Ternus performance) and the adjacent medial geniculate nucleus (MGN; affecting phonological ability) and the MGN abnormalities may be more functionally related to poor nonword reading.  相似文献

Although growing up in stressful conditions can undermine mental abilities, people in harsh environments may develop intact, or even enhanced, social and cognitive abilities for solving problems in high‐adversity contexts (i.e. ‘hidden talents’). We examine whether childhood and current exposure to violence are associated with memory (number of learning rounds needed to memorize relations between items) and reasoning performance (accuracy in deducing a novel relation) on transitive inference tasks involving both violence‐relevant and violence‐neutral social information (social dominance vs. chronological age). We hypothesized that individuals who had more exposure to violence would perform better than individuals with less exposure on the social dominance task. We tested this hypothesis in a preregistered study in 100 Dutch college students and 99 Dutch community participants. We found that more exposure to violence was associated with lower overall memory performance, but not with reasoning performance. However, the main effects of current (but not childhood) exposure to violence on memory were qualified by significant interaction effects. More current exposure to neighborhood violence was associated with worse memory for age relations, but not with memory for dominance relations. By contrast, more current personal involvement in violence was associated with better memory for dominance relations, but not with memory for age relations. These results suggest incomplete transfer of learning and memory abilities across contents. This pattern of results, which supports a combination of deficits and ‘hidden talents,’ is striking in relation to the broader developmental literature, which has nearly exclusively reported deficits in people from harsh conditions. Recent research with English developmental dyslexics comparing the picture naming performance of these children to the picture naming performance of non-dyslexic (‘garden variety’) poor readers, reading age matched controls and chronological age matched controls has suggested that a selective difficulty in retrieving the phonological codes of known names on demand underlies the picture naming deficit found in developmental dyslexia (Swan & Goswami, Picture naming deficits in developmental dyslexia: the phonological representations hypothesis, Brain and Language, 56 (1997), 334–353). If the underlying causal factors in dyslexia are independent of the orthography that the child is learning to read, then a difficulty in retrieving the phonological codes of known names on demand should also be found in developmental dyslexics who are learning to read other languages. We therefore set out to replicate Swan and Goswami’s study with a group of German developmental dyslexics. We were interested to see whether a phonological deficit is characteristic of dyslexia in all orthographies, even those, such as German, in which high orthographic transparency means that dyslexic children read with considerable accuracy.  相似文献

Jorm (1979a) has drawn attention to similarities between developmental dyslexia and acquired deep dyslexia, an analogy which has been criticized by A. W. Ellis (1979). A series of three experiments compared the two syndromes, using the techniques applied by Patterson and Marcel (1977) to adult deep dyslexics, to study a group of 15 boys suffering from developmental dyslexia. Patterson and Marcel's patients were able to perform a lexical decision task but showed no evidence of phonemic encoding of nonwords; our dyslexic children performed this task very slowly and with reduced accuracy but showed clear evidence of phonemic coding of the nonword items. Patterson and Marcel observed that their patients could not read out orthographically regular nonwords; our dyslexic children were able to do this task, although more slowly and somewhat less accurately than their chronological age or reading age controls. Finally, Patterson and Marcel observed that highly imageable words were more likely to be read correctly than words of equal frequency but low imageability; we observed a similar effect in both our dyslexic group and in their reading age controls. This implies that the imageability effect may not be peculiar to dyslexics but may be characteristic of normal reading under certain conditions. It is concluded that developmental dyslexics differ from the patients studied by Patterson and Marcel in demonstrating a pattern of reading which, though slow, is qualitatively similar to the reading of normal readers of a younger age. As such, our results do not support Jorm's position.  相似文献

An experiment that examined the way in which young readers deployed eye movements while reading sentences and while answering questions containing either a pronominal or noun anaphor is reported. To evaluate the possible causal role played by differences in inspection strategies between readers of above- and below-average reading skill, a third“age control” group of younger children was also tested. This group was matched on absolute reading ability with the less skilled group of older children, and on relative reading ability (i.e. reading quotient) with the more skilled group. Differences in inspection strategy were apparent between the groups of good and poor readers. Good readers launched more selective reinspections, whereas the poorer readers were more inclined to engage in“backtracking” and appeared to make less use of the displayed text. In every case there was a marked similarity in the behaviour of the good readers and the“age controls”. These results suggest that the ability to code the spatial location of words in a sentence, and, where necessary, to use this information to launch accurately targetted selective reinspections of previously read text, plays a crucial role in the development of skilled reading performance.  相似文献

本研究对汉语阅读障碍的加工缺陷进行探讨,期望有助于揭示语言加工的普遍性与特殊性,以及阅读障碍的成因,并可为后期的干预提供帮助。研究采用改编的言语认知测验对阅读水平匹配组与阅读障碍组和生理年龄匹配组进行比较后发现,阅读障碍组在语音意识和正字法加工任务上的成绩均明显差于生理年龄控制组和阅读水平匹配组;阅读障碍组在快速命名和语音记忆任务上的成绩不如生理年龄匹配组,仅达到阅读水平匹配组水平。因此,汉语发展性阅读障碍儿童存在语音意识和正字法加工缺陷,这两种缺陷可能是阅读障碍儿童面临的最主要的两大缺陷;阅读障碍儿童在快速命名和语音记忆上的不足可能是发展迟滞所致。同时,大多数的汉语阅读障碍儿童存在不止一种的认知缺陷。阅读障碍儿童在语音意识和正字法加工上存在缺陷的比例最高。  相似文献

We investigated the extent to which inhibition, updating, shifting, and mental-attentional capacity (M-capacity) contribute to children’s ability to solve multiplication word problems. A total of 155 children in Grades 3–6 (8- to 13-year-olds) completed a set of multiplication word problems at two levels of difficulty: one-step and multiple-step problems. They also received a reading comprehension test and a battery of inhibition, updating, shifting, and M-capacity measures. Structural equation modeling showed that updating mediated the relationship between multiplication performance (controlling for reading comprehension score) and latent attentional factors M-capacity and inhibition. Updating played a more important role in predicting performance on multiple-step problems than did age, whereas age and updating were equally important predictors on one-step problems. Shifting was not a significant predictor in either model. Implications of proposing executive function updating as a mediator between mathematical cognition and chronological age and attention resources are discussed.  相似文献
